**Wiki: Upload Encoding Detection (Session Layer)**

Quillgate sniffs the first 4KB of uploaded text files. BOM wins; otherwise a UTF-8 validity pass, then a Latin-1 fallback. Detection result is pinned to the session so re-reads stay consistent. Mixed-encoding files are rejected, not coerced. Detector runs pre-auth context, post-session-bind.

Reviewer can exercise the detection endpoint on staging using the token below.

login token, bagug-kafop: eyJhbGciOiJIUzI1NiIsInR5cCI6IkpXVCJ9.eyJzdWIiOiIcMLov2In0.Z5RLDIfp

MEMO — Department Heads

Effective end of Q3, Harwick Instruments retires the Veltro gauge line. No new orders after June. Support continues 12 months for existing contracts. Inventory transfers to the Calden Falls depot; production staff reassign to the Orix line. Direct customer questions to commercial ops, not engineering. Margins no longer justify continuation. The replacement strategy is summarized below.

board note of yajeg-yaweg: The pricing group signed off on a budget of $4.9 million for Project Quenix. The renewal with Sormirek Freight closes at $6.1 million a year, 37 percent below the last contract.

Compaction jobs scan each partition's segment files, drop superseded records, and write compacted segments back through the Ledgerline internal API. On-call engineers should know that a stalled compaction run usually means the service account's token was rejected, not that the queue itself is unhealthy. Check the compactor logs for authentication errors before restarting anything. If you need to re-run compaction manually, authenticate against Ledgerline using the key below.

API key for yahig-tadup: kto7_ubizbYm

**Vendor note: Inkmill markdown pipeline**

Rendering for Parchway docs is outsourced to Inkmill under an annual contract, renewing each March. They handle sanitization and PDF export; we own the upload queue. SLA: 4-hour response on rendering failures. Escalate only after two failed retries. Their support desk is reachable at the address below.

billing contact of hahaf-baguf = zorael.tammir.jorius@sivrelhq.internal